BROWN TOWNSHIP, OH (THECOUNT) — Samuel Stephen Buckland, of Howard, OH, has been identified as the victim in a two-vehicle crash Sunday evening in Delaware County.

Buckland, 47, was killed in a crash in Sunbury, Ohio on Sunday night.

According to officials, Buckland was operating a Mercedes on State Route 521 near CR-35 in Brown Township around 6 p.m. Sunday, when 49-year-old Mary K. Hollar rear-ended Buckland while operating a Chrysler SUV.

It was determined Hollar failed to yield at a stop sign.

Buckland, formerly of Largo, Florida, Radcliff, KY and Fredericktown, OH, was pronounced dead at the scene.

He was wearing a seatbelt, reports MyFox.

Hollar was rushed to Wexner Medical Center by a Survival Flight helicopter, per troopers. Hollar’s passengers, which included a 9-year-old, a 10-year-old, and an 11-year-old were taken by ambulance to Nationwide Children’s Hospital. Troopers said all children were secured properly, but Hollar was not wearing a seatbelt.

Alcohol and drugs were not suspected factors.

The crash remains under investigation.
